Output dd591251215ad13dc9394d051d31ef611aac3e1054d05365a7d24ebba269cea4:4

value
758040
script pubkey
OP_0 OP_PUSHBYTES_20 bbcc877e4a8abf0fbb303f25d46e2d383e6d6e1d
address
bc1qh0xgwlj232lslwes8ujagm3d8qlx6msamjlv4t
transaction
dd591251215ad13dc9394d051d31ef611aac3e1054d05365a7d24ebba269cea4
spent
true